Transaction 39d62ff905473d96b1b73197d9a30bd82804fff6636669712e16843afd73b813
1 Input
2 Outputs
- 39d62ff905473d96b1b73197d9a30bd82804fff6636669712e16843afd73b813:0
- 39d62ff905473d96b1b73197d9a30bd82804fff6636669712e16843afd73b813:1
value 546
address 1PG4wn7fztrBmvCe8VA1dzjZ5w4wRr7oKN
value 316458793
address 1FGiTjZZJs8H3B29Gz7VFoA76QvfbxrpmX